Tuition Tax Credit (1098-T)

Tax Benefits for Higher Education

The American Opportunity (formerly Hope) and Lifetime Learning tax credits that may be available to you if you pay higher education costs. To assist you in claiming these credits, Marshall University will file form 1098-T with the Internal Revenue Service by January 31 each year.  This information in no way represents tax advice from the University, as it is  the responsibility of the taxpayer to determine eligibility for the credit.  Please do not contact Marshall University regarding your eligibility for this credit.

To obtain more information on the American Opportunity and Lifetime Learning tax credits, please refer to IRS Publication 970 – Tax Benefits for Higher Education or contact the Internal Revenue Service directly at 1-800-829-1040.  For specific questions concerning information provided within your 1098-T please contact Marshall University at 1-800-438-5389.
